The Cultural Significance of Town Names
Cultural identifiers are integral to the naming conventions of Israeli towns. Many place names derive from Hebrew roots and carry significances that go beyond mere labels. For example, ancient towns like Jerusalem and Bethlehem anchor historical narratives and cultural ideas that resonate throughout generations. Each name can embody stories of resilience, faith, and change.
Analyzing specific examples reveals patterns in Israeli town naming. The word « Kiryat, » meaning « town, » appears consistently, accompanied by names of notable historical figures or places. Other names may refer to natural features, such as « Hatzor, » which translates to « a fortress. » This connection to geography and history together promotes a deeper appreciation for the overarching narratives behind these locations.
